16/09/2008 ALISON Offers Web Database Solutions Via its Partner Texunatech
ALISON and Texunatech (Texuna Technologies Ltd.) have joined forces creating a partnership focused on delivering contracts to the public sector internationally. The development and project management experience of Texunatech, allied with the content development, e-learning platform and editorial expertise of ALISON, creates an exciting solutions provider for clients managing large databases of information in the government, education and skills sectors worldwide.
Texunatech is a leading technology solutions and outsourcing service provider. The company delivers software development services and business process outsourcing for large organizations. These services are based upon Texunatech’s tried and tested Soltex technology platform. Texunatech clients include the Training and Development Agency for Schools (TDA), EduBase, and Lifelong Learning UK. Texunatech typically provides full life-cycle service to its clients, encompassing:
- Project management;
- Business analysis;
- System implementation, integration and testing;
- System support and maintenance; and
- System and service operation.
Texunatech was established in 2000, and since then has worked extensively with and within government agencies. With proven experience of developing and deploying public-sector systems utilizing Web technology, databases, integration, reporting and publication in a highly secure environment, the partnership with ALISON adds significant value to the Texunatech offering within the education, learning and skills sector.
Texunatech's relevant experience includes:
- Consultation with the Department for Innovation, Universities and Skills (DIUS) and a number of educational bodies, including: the Qualifications and Curriculum Authority (QCA); the Learning and Skills Council (LSC), and, the Managing Information Across Partners (MIAP) Programme management team on the topic of education-related data record management;
- involvement in the MIAP Concept Viability study with Intellect;
- listing as a potential MIAP prime vendor, a strong indicator of Texunatech’s ability to meet the change management needs of the educational sector; and facilitating a Special Interest Group (SIG) between Sector Skills Councils (SSCs) within the Skills For Business network

ALISON Launched in April 2007, ALISON provides
freely accessible learning to individual learners. With registered
learners in every country and territory worldwide, its mission is to
enable anyone, anywhere, to educate themselves for free via interactive
self-paced multimedia. Based in Galway, Ireland, the focus of ALISON is
interactive learning for basic and essential life and workplace skills.
